Andean Amerindians and agricultural cooperatives during the Junta de Adelanto de Arica: Lluta, Azapa and the Andes foothills (1962-1976). Idesia [online]. 2012, vol.30, n.1, pp. 127-135. ISSN 0718-3429. http://dx.doi.org/10.4067/S0718-34292012000100016.
This article examines from a historical perspective the implementation of Cooperatives in the Department of Arica (1962-1976) and the participation of Andean farmers in these organizations. We describe the policies of the Corporation of Agrarian Reform, specifically, the actions of the Junta de Adelanto of Arica to promote association among indigenous peasants in the valleys and mountains of the extreme north of Chile.
